Chad Salvador/2026GG/Penske Media Jennifer Lawrence opened up to Vogue about her relationship to cosmetic procedures and said she resists going overboard when it comes to botox because she is a working actor and facial movement is of the upmost important. The Oscar winner’s comment was published just a few weeks after Olivia Wilde put the industry on blast, telling Vogue that “it’s not easy” to find actresses to cast in movies because many of them can no longer move their faces.
“I can’t really get very much done,” Lawrence told Vogue. “I need to have movement in my face — I get baby Botox, but I can’t do a lot. If my skin is going to be a little saggier than I would like, at least it looks dewy and pretty.”
